Everyone is HAPPY! The resort grounds are beautiful, the staff is amazing, even the vacationers are happy! Love this place!! We stayed at the sunset villa side with a great pool right outside our villa. They have TONS of activities for kids and my son really enjoyed playing kickball and dodge ball instead of always being on the water. My only complaint is that the villa itself definitely needed some renovations. Will stay here again, hopefully soon!!

We had a wonderful time at the Hawks Cay Resort! We stayed in a villa in Sanctuary Village perfect for families with kids. Our favorite parts were definitely swimming with dolphins, nights by the fire, dinners at Angler and Ale, and family time spent at the many pools. We were also impressed by all the activities offered for kids! We are already looking forward to our next trip!

Entire facility and our accommodations were all excellent. Not sure if it makes a difference but we booked through Hawks Cay. We stayed with another family (5 kids and 4 adults) and the townhouse was in great shape, clean and very nice. Everything was within walking distance. Restaurants, pools, and services were all great. The fishing charter with Captain Dave was the best part of the trip. You get to keep the catch and The Angler and Ale will cook up the catch for you. There is a lot for the kids to do as well. Highly recommend.
